Real Estate Investing
Real Estate Investing refers to the purchase, ownership, management, rental, or sale of real estate properties for profit. This investment strategy involves allocating capital to acquire residential, commercial, or industrial properties with the expectation that they will appreciate in value over time or generate rental income. Investors may engage in various forms of real estate investing, such as buying single-family homes, multifamily units, commercial properties, or real estate investment trusts (REITs). The goal is to capitalize on market trends, leverage financing options, and manage properties effectively to maximize returns on investment. Real estate investing can serve as a long-term wealth-building strategy and a means of diversifying an investment portfolio.
